On 8 September 2018, Iran's Islamic Revolutionary Guards Corps (IRGC) launched seven Fateh-110 missiles at the headquarters of two Iranian Kurdish opposition parties in Koy Sanjaq, located in Iraq's semi-autonomous Kurdish region. Initial reports from Iranian news agencies listed 11 killed people. Later reports indicated 18 people were killed.
